Fully Multi-coated optics effectively reduces reflected light and increases the transmission of light giving you a brighter image than normal single coated lenses
Argon Purging uses the inertia gas with bigger size molecules to purge any moisture out of the tube giving you better waterproofing and thermal stability.
XPL Coating gives you an extra protection on the exterior lenses from dirt, oil and scratches.
Precision Zero Stop System allows you to return to your zero position and dial back to it with a sharp and precise stop right at your zero location.
APLR2 FFP IR MOA reticle has a large illuminated center with 1 moa hash mark increments and drop lines in 5 moa increment on vertical direction down to 40 moa, both of which help you quickly lock in your target and set holdover positions. The illuminated portion has a 2 moa span center cross with illuminated cross line extends to 40 moa on both vertical and horizontal direction. The unique design of having droplines going down to 40 moa with 5 moa between each drop line and 1 moa hash marks in between provide excellent hold over positions for long precision shooting.
Subtensions in MOA: A1 (0.14); A2 (2); A3 (0.3); B1 (2); B2 (1.5); B3 (0.5); B4 (1); C1 (1); C2 (2); C3 (1); C4 (5); C5 (10); D1 (0.2); D2 (0.3).
